# Session Handling for Pagewright Rebuilds

Incremental rebuilds in Pagewright reuse a single authenticated session across all changed pages, so we don't hammer the Fenwick content API with logins. The session worker refreshes itself roughly every forty minutes — if you see a flurry of 401s in the rebuild log, that refresh probably raced a deploy. Don't bother tweaking the retry knobs; they're fine. When testing locally, the rebuild CLI expects you to export the token shown below.

session JWT of yawep-yawep = eyJhbGciOiJIUzI1NiIsInR5cCI6IkpXVCJ9.eyJzdWIiOiI3pWF3_In0.aXYsHiog

Minutes — Management Meeting, Kestrel Fabrication Division

Attendees: senior management, chaired by R. Osmund. Agreed: immediate hiring freeze across Kestrel Fabrication, excluding safety-critical roles, pending the cost review. Open requisitions withdrawn; contractors unaffected for now. HR to brief team leads by Friday. Review in eight weeks. The rationale ties to plans recorded below for the board.

management briefing: Project Ulavan slips by two quarters because of the staffing delay.

CHIPREAD-207: Vault sealed on finish-line unit

Heads up, future maintainers — the Striderly timing-chip reader at the Kelber Marathon rig locked its config vault after a firmware flash went sideways. The reader works, but we can't push new race profiles until it's unsealed. Don't reflash; just unlock it with the recovery passphrase below.

vault phrase of taweg-kafof = oliax-zorael

## Turnstile counter drift at Harrow Field Arena

If the Gatecount dashboard lags the physical tally by more than 2%, the edge relay at the north concourse has usually dropped its sync job. Restart the relay, then replay the buffered events via the reconcile endpoint. The replay call must be authorized with the bearer token below.

login token, bagug-kafop: eyJhbGciOiJIUzI1NiIsInR5cCI6IkpXVCJ9.eyJzdWIiOiIcMLov2In0.Z5RLDIfp

## Tuning

Relevance in the Lanternquery engine is governed by a small set of boost weights and decay factors. Plugin authors should treat these as the baseline: custom scorers multiply against them rather than replacing them, so extreme overrides will distort blended results. The defaults shipped with this release are shown below.

tuning table, fawip-fahag:
WEIGHTS = {
    "novwyn": 452,
    "casdor": 675,
}